EM waves are used in everyday life through technologies like cell phones, which use radio waves for communication. Another example is in microwave ovens, which use microwaves to heat food quickly and efficiently.
Radar uses electromagnetic waves, specifically radio waves, to detect the range, angle, or velocity of objects such as aircraft, ships, spacecraft, guided missiles, motor vehicles, weather formations, and terrain.
